Bunk Bed Safety Guidelines

Bunk beds are a unique and fun method of accommodating more people in a smaller space. They can also be ideal for homes with older children and teens.

Single bunk beds over double beds are a popular choice for families with younger children. They have twin beds on top and an ordinary double bed on the bottom.

Space-saving Solution

Bunk beds can be a wonderful space-saving solution for bedrooms with small spaces. They can make children feel more secure, and create a fun environment in the room that is shared. Many bunk bed frames have drawers built in which can be used for storing clothes or toys, as well as other personal objects. A single bunk bed is also cheaper than two separate beds. This is especially true when you factor in the price of furniture and mattresses.

There is a bunkbed that can be a good fit for your family, whether you're looking for a traditional twin-over-double bunk bed or something modern and unique. Some models come with the option of a trundle that allows for a third person to be accommodated without taking up a lot of floor space. This is great for kids who are often sleeping over or families that require an efficient sleeping solution for the guest room.

When selecting a bunk bed, look for safety features such as a ladder and guardrails that are solid on the top bunk. Make sure the mattress is firm and comfortable to ensure a good night's sleep. Some brands also include a warranty for added security.

A bunk bed isn't just a great solution for small spaces, but it can also add a touch of style to your home. You can pick from a variety of designs and colors to match your decor. Bunk beds can be used to accommodate guests. They are available in a variety of sizes, from twin over twin up to full over queen.

A bunk bed with an L shape is another space-saving solution. This design is ideal for rooms with a limited space for floor space and fits well under an escalator. The L-shaped variant of bunk beds provides more privacy in each sleeping area than conventional bunk beds. It is also ideal for children younger than a year old who require more space to play.

If you're looking to get the most out of your bunk bed, you should consider buying a bed that converts into individual single beds. This way, you'll take advantage of the bunk bed experience as your child gets older and then switch to a regular single or double bed as they grow older.

Fun and unique

A bunk bed is often considered to be a kids' bedroom essential, a space saver and a great way to keep siblings happy in the same room. These brilliant beds are so more than that. They can give kids a unique sleeping experience that will make bedtime an adventure. They can also create a shared space for play and learning, which is ideal for siblings sharing a room or for friends staying over.

Typically, bunk beds consist of two stylish twin or full size beds stacked one on top of the other. They're usually accessible by a ladder or stool, and guard rails are positioned on the sides of the upper bunk to prevent kids from rolling out of their bed. They're a great choice for homes with limited floor space, and they can easily be dismantled later on to create separate beds.

Bunk beds can be made in different shapes and sizes. They can look like rocket ship, race car or castle and they're a great choice for children who enjoy a creative design. Some bunk beds feature secret hiding places and built-in storage that create a sense of mystery.

If you want to take your children's bunk bed to the next level, think about a L-shaped bunk or a T-shaped loft bed. These alternatives take an ordinary loft-style bunk and add a second twin or full bed beneath at a perpendicular angle. They might not be as good in securing space as the traditional bunk bed however, they're an excellent way to add additional sleeping space to a smaller bedroom and make it appear more spacious.

The great thing about bunk beds is that they're designed to evolve with your children. As they get older they'll appreciate the security and safety that a lower bed provides. Plus, with the ability to separate bunk beds and triple bunk beds, you don't have to worry about rushing out to purchase new beds when your children begin to outgrow them.

Bunk beds can be ideal for saving space in a child's bedroom however, they can also pose a safety risk when they are not used properly. Most bunk bed injuries can be avoided with the proper information and adhering to safety guidelines.

The most important thing to keep in mind when using a bunk bed is that it must be used solely for sleeping and not for play or other activities. Children should not be able to climb on the bunk beds or in under them. Only one person should sleep in the top bunk. Install a nightlight next to the ladder and ensure it is free of toys and other objects that could cause an accident. Children should not hang anything on the bunks, like belts and jump ropes, as this poses the risk of strangulation.

Aside from ensuring that the bunk bed is correctly assembled, it's also an excellent idea to regularly inspect the frame and mattress support system for signs of wear and tear. A few minor creaks or swaying can be a sign of more serious issues, so it's crucial to act swiftly whenever you notice these signs.

In addition, it's vital to select a mattress that is suitable for bunk beds, since different mattresses will sit at different levels within the frame of the bed. Ideally, the mattress should be no more than four inches higher than the lowest bunk. This will allow children to safely climb up and down the ladder without hitting their head on the guardrail.

The foundations of bunk bed triple beds are an additional important safety aspect. They must be securely attached to the wall and constructed of durable materials. Make sure the bunk beds are checked to make sure there are no gaps between the frames and the foundations. They could pose a danger to young children. It is also a good idea for parents to teach their children proper ladder climbing techniques and to keep the bunk beds free of clutter at all times.

Bunk beds are a great option to maximize the space available in the bedroom of your child, while permitting them to play with their friends.
